Abstract
Hochfester stickstoffhaltiger vollaustenitischer Kobaltstahl mit einem Rp0,2-Dehngrenzenwert oberhalb 600 N/mm², dadurch hergestellt, daß in einem vollaustenitischen Chrom-Nickel-Stahl, dessen Stickstoffgehalt mindestens 50 % oberhalb der Stickstofflöslichkeitsgrenze bei Normaldruck liegt, das Legierungselement Nickel ganz oder teilweise durch das Legierungselement Kobalt substituiert wird, der Stahl anschließend bei einer Temperatur von 1050 °C bis 1200 °C einer Lösungsglühung unterzogen und dann in Wasser abgeschreckt wird. High-strength, nitrogen-containing, fully austenitic cobalt steel with an R p0.2 proof stress value above 600 N / mm², produced in a fully austenitic chromium-nickel steel, the nitrogen content of which is at least 50% above the nitrogen solubility limit at normal pressure, completely or partially through the alloying element nickel the alloying element is substituted for cobalt, the steel is then subjected to solution treatment at a temperature of 1050 ° C. to 1200 ° C. and then quenched in water.
